About this work

Diplomatic stationary, second half 17th century. Special envelopes were used for diplomatic correspondence. The velvet envelope contained a letter (dated 20 September 1686) from the emperor of Morocco to the States General concerning deliveries of weapons from the Republic. The silk envelope contained a letter sent in 1668 by the Dutch representative in Constantinople (Istanbul), Justinus Coljer, to the States General. The painting above shows a Russian diplomatic delegation at the Binnenhof in The Hague bearing a sealed envelope. On loan from Algemeen Rijksarchief, Den Haag.
